Kingston has added a new 32 GB Secure Digital High-Capacity (SDHC) model to its Elite Pro serie. Kingston reports that due to its size, the memory card is perfectly suited for use in HD-videocamera's and high-resolution digital camera's. 

kingston_ep_32gb

The SDHC cards in the Elite Pro serie have dimensions of 24 x 32 x 2.1 mm and come in capacities of 4, 8, 16 and now 32 GB. With the Speed Class 4 label, Kingston guarantees a transit speed of atleast 4 MByte/sec. The cards also feature a switch to prevent accidental erase of data.

All memory cards in the Elite Pro SDHC line-up have a lifetime warranty. The 32 GB model has a recommended price of  €173,- (excl. VAT) and should become available soon.
